FLORIDA PANTHERS vs. DETROIT RED WINGS
MARCH 30, 2021
BB&T Center – Sunrise, Fla.
FLORIDA PANTHERS | DETROIT RED WINGS |
4 | 1 |
- The Panthers improved to 23-9-4 with victories in each of their past three games. The Cats have won four of their past five games at BB&T Center, and are the third NHL team to reach the 50-point mark this season.
- Florida reached the 50-point mark in their 36th game of the season, the second-fewest games required to reach 50 points in franchise history (34 GP in 1995-96).
- With the win, Florida improved to 5-2-0 vs. DET this season and 12-2-1 in their past 15 matchups against the Red Wings.
- Carter Verhaeghe recorded two goals, his third multi-goal game of the season. He has amassed five goals (5-1-6) over his past three games.
- Verhaeghe has scored 15 even-strength goals this season, tied for the league lead. He registered a personal season-high six shots on goal tonight.
- Verhaeghe ranks second in goals (17) and points (30) among players with a new team in 2020-21 (per NHL PR).
- Sergei Bobrovsky stopped 35 of 36 DET shots (.972 save percentage) and improved his career record vs. DET to 18-6-1.
- Jonathan Huberdeau scored his 14th goal of the season 17 seconds into the first period, the fastest goal by a Panther start a game this season.
- With the goal,Huberdeau extended his point streak to three games (3-2-5). He led FLA with 23:54 TOI tonight.
- Brett Connolly tallied his 100th NHL goal.
- Owen Tippett notched an assist, extending his point streak to three games (1-2-3).
- Anthony Duclair posted an assist, extending his point streak to two games (1-1-2). He did not return for the third period, leaving the game with an upper body injury.
- Gustav Forsling produced an assist and led FLA’s defensemen with 21:27 TOI.
- Radko Gudas registered four hits and led FLA with three blocked shots.
- Florida out-hit DET 29-26, led by Eetu Luostarinen (5).
